Geminal

Two halides next to each other at a "corner"

Vicinal

Two halides next to each other along one side of a chain

Free radical halogenation

a high yield process that takes place via a very stable allylic radical (assuming allylic hydrogen is present). The allylic position is the carbon directly attached to the alkene.
